Subject: [PATCH v2 08/10] led: gpio: Default to using node name if label is absent

This more closely mirrors Linux's behaviour, and will make it easier to
transition to using function+color in the future.

drivers/led/led_gpio.c | 7 ++-----
1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 5 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/led/led_gpio.c b/drivers/led/led_gpio.c
index ef9b61ee62..2cdb0269f4 100644
--- a/drivers/led/led_gpio.c
+++ b/drivers/led/led_gpio.c
@@ -99,11 +99,8 @@ static int led_gpio_bind(struct udevice *parent)
const char *label;
label = ofnode_read_string(node, "label");
- if (!label) {
- debug("%s: node %s has no label\n", __func__,
- ofnode_get_name(node));
- return -EINVAL;
- }
+ if (!label)
+ label = ofnode_get_name(node);
ret = device_bind_driver_to_node(parent, "gpio_led",
ofnode_get_name(node),
node, &dev);
